It's easy for you to maintain.

uPVC is the best choice for window materials for your home. It's a sturdy material that's low-maintenance and can last for 40 years. It is also very eco-friendly which makes it a great choice for your home. UPVC is widely known for its durability and rigidity. It won't crack or warp in the most extreme weather conditions.

uPVC isn't just easy to maintain, it's much less expensive than other materials. This is particularly true if you're on the market for new windows.

Many modern homes and buildings are built with energy-efficient appliances and systems, making window maintenance crucial. To keep your UPVC looking its best, it's recommended to clean it at least every year.

A mild window cleaner can be used to clean UPVC windows. This will ensure that your glass is streak-free. However, do not use harsh cleaners or colored cloths. They can scratch UPVC and be hard to get off of your windows.

Certain manufacturers have specific cleaning products that provide better results than just using a damp cloth. To get rid of dirt and grime, you could also purchase a window sprayer. You can also wipe it off using a sponge and warm soapy water.

UPVC doors are easy to maintain. Spray oil is recommended to be applied on a regular basis. The oil will help protect your door from weather damage, and will also ensure that your locks and hinges remain in good shape.

A UPVC doormat is a different uPVC product. It will reduce the noise that your home can generate and is a great option for those who reside in a colder region.

For older style uPVC windows, you may prefer a specialist cloth to revive your windows. The most effective way to change the appearance of your home look is to select the appropriate material.

Your UPVC windows will last for years with little care and effort. Additionally, they'll have a stylish, sleek look and you'll pay less money on maintenance.

It's weather-resistant

Weather resistant uPVC windows provide a variety of advantages. They are easy to set up and maintain, and are excellent for the environment. UPVC is also a long-lasting inexpensive material that offers an excellent value for money.

You can pick from a range of styles, colours and frames that will complement your home's style. uPVC is not just weather-resistant but also fire- and termite-proof. It is sturdy and provides high insulation, which keeps your home warm even during the coldest of winter.

Unlike regular windows uPVC is extremely airtight. This means that no air is allowed to leak through gaps and there is no need to wash the window manually. Additionally, uPVC is made from green materials.

Many manufacturers offer UPVC window frames that feature thermal breaks. These thermal breaks reduce the flow of heat through the frame, which keeps your home cooler during summer.

As opposed to wood windows uPVC is not susceptible to rotting, corroded or affected by salt. Additionally, it is insensitive to humidity, which could cause wood to rot.

UPVC can be used as a frame for doors and is a good option for window frames. A UPVC door will last longer than a wood door and is less difficult to replace.

UPVC is also simple to clean, which is a plus for homeowners of all types. Whether you're cleaning a window or an entranceway, it's easy to clean dirt and dirt. UPVC is resistant to snow, rain and dust storms, making it an ideal choice for any weather.

UPVC windows are flexible and can be tailored to any style of architecture. UPVC windows provide exceptional thermal comfort as well as low thermal conductivity. The windows also offer effective insulation, which will help keep your home warmer in the winter months and cooler in summer.
